Karl Lukas
Karol Louis Lukasiak (August 21, 1919 - January 16, 1995) was an American film and television actor. He was best known for playing Pvt. Stash Kadowski in The Phil Silvers Show. Lukas guest-starred in numerous television programs, including, The Andy Griffith Show, Gunsmoke, Bonanza, The Rockford Files, The Dick Van Dyke Show, Rawhide, Wagon Train, The Beverly Hillbillies, Alfred Hitchcock Presents, The F.B.I., Petticoat Junction and The Monkees. He also appeared in a few episodes of Family Affair, Bewitched and Mister Ed. Lukas died in January 1995 of heart failure in Westlake Village, California, at the age of 75.
